A NOC Technician is responsible for monitoring network systems, identifying and addressing outages or performance issues, and escalating critical incidents to appropriate teams. Daily tasks often include analyzing system alerts, running diagnostics, performing routine maintenance, and documenting all network activity. You will also collaborate with other IT professionals, such as engineers and support staff, to resolve problems efficiently and keep services running smoothly. The role usually involves working in shifts to provide 24/7 network coverage, ensuring maximum uptime for clients or internal users.
